Output 8d50574b6f84d075799fad4df2be16b18fc9c01b11019c5ccb3b333dc01c5f9b:1

value
6822645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e441d886c0c1b798bd573fb7e054965d5a7ee25 OP_EQUAL
address
3EfFUXETGoH6ybQrBDRmxoSmvm9iLQzsMm
transaction
8d50574b6f84d075799fad4df2be16b18fc9c01b11019c5ccb3b333dc01c5f9b
spent
true